The Chancay Mega-port in an under-construction port in Chancay, Peru. It is nearing completion and is being built by Chinese company Cosco Shipping.[1]

The port is located approximately 60 kilometers nor of Lima. It is expected to cost $1.3 billion USD. The route betweeen China and the port will be reduced to 10 days.[2]

Offering a deep water port, Chancay will be able to handle container ships that can’t dock elsewhere in South America.[3]

Peruvian mining company Volcan will own a 40% share of the company and COSCO Shipping will hold the remaining 60%.[4]

The first stage of the port is expected to be finished by the end of 2024.[5]
